Hi,
it is possible to achieve the state you describe. You just can’t have ovirtmgmt
as VM network in such case.
You need to set ovirtmgmt as nonVM [1] (aka bridgeless network), then you can
put it on one interface with VLANs.
Be aware that you can put on one interface only one bridges network
